What are standard front door widths?

Standard entry door measurements: Height: 80 inches (6 feet 8 inches) Thickness: 1 3/4 inches. Width: 36 inches standard (30 and 32inches also available)

Is a 36 door actually 36 wide?

For example, a nominal door size of 36 inches would fit into a rough opening 36 inches wide. The actual size of the door slab may be slightly smaller than the nominal size, typically by about 3/4 inch on each side, allowing for clearance around the door to ensure it can open and close smoothly.

What is the rough opening for a 36 inch door?

For a standard 36-inch exterior door, the rough opening should typically be 38 inches wide and 82.5 inches tall. This allows for a 2-inch margin on the sides and a 0.5-inch margin at the top for the door frame.

What is the narrowest door width?

Standard Interior Door Width

Some older closet doors are as narrow as 18 inches, but in modern homes they are 30 inches in width. The standard interior door width is 28 to 32 inches. Other sizes include 24 and 36 inches (the latter size is the optimal width to accommodate a person with disabilities).

What is the glass panel next to a front door called?

Sidelight

A sidelight is a fixed glass panel with a frame that is mulled, or installed, on one or both sides of an exterior door. Sidelights, like doorlights, can consist of decorative or clear glass in a variety of sizes.

What does "prehung door" mean?

A pre-hung door is a door set consisting of everything that you need to install it into your opening. A slab door is simply just the door. A slab door is included in pre-hung doors. The difference being that the slab door in a pre-hung set will come with the frame and hinges already attached.

What is the bottom plate of a front door called?

Sill. Sills are the bottom component of a door frame. They are the part of the door that gets sealed and fastened to the floor. Only exterior doors (those that lead to the outdoors or garages) have sills.

What is the standard front door width?

Standard Size for Exterior Doors

The standard size for an exterior door is 80 inches by 36 inches which is 6 ft, 8 inches by 3 ft. 96 inches or 8 ft. is now very common for newer homes and stock exterior doors are also commonly available in 30 and 32-inch widths.

How wide can my front door be?

The standard size for a front door is 36” x 80”, or about 3' x 6'7”. Beyond this, you can find exterior door sizes ranging from as narrow as 30” to as tall as 96”. If you have a double door entryway, the standard size will be 72” x 80”, or double the width of a single front door with the same height.

What does 2868 door mean?

By comparison, a 2868 door is 2' 8" or 2 feet 8 inches wide and 6' by 8" (6 feet 8 inches) tall. A window is noted the same way; for example, a 4016 window is 4'0 wide by 1'6" tall.

How much can you take off the width of a door?

Most internal door manufacturers advise different trimming tolerances so as a standard and to be on the safe side we advise that you don't trim more than 5mm per side. This is with the exception of LPD, which only allows 3mm on each side.

What is the narrowest exterior door?

The smallest standard exterior door size typically measures 30 inches wide by 80 inches tall. This size is often used for entry doors in smaller homes or as secondary doors, such as those leading to a backyard or patio.
